The alpaca is a charming and valuable member of the Camelid family....
They are a herd animal native to the Andes Mountains in South America. Alpacas are prized for their luxurious and costly fiber. Alpaca fleece is a durable
and warm natural fiber that is delightfully soft to the touch. Nothing could be finer or more pleasurable to work with than pure alpaca fiber.
Alpaca is a hypoallergenic, water resistant natural fiber with the softness of cashmere and the strength of modern synthetics.
Alpaca blankets, sofa throws, scarves, vest, sweaters and jackets are a cherished possession, frequently handed down from one generation to the next.

T3 Alpaca Yarn is our main line of yarn that we have been carrying in our studio for the past 10 years. It is a commercial grade alpaca yarn that works great for scarves, sofa throws, hats, gloves, mittens etc. It is considered a heavy worsted, 130 yards per 4 oz. skein, needle size 10, guage 4 - 4.5 stitches per inch. One skein will make a hat or a pair of mitten (8 needle) and two skeins will make a scarf. This is a great line of yarn, due to the size it works up quickly and since it is heavier it give a nice thick end product.
